flag HMRC notifies UK households of unexpected tax bills due to increased savings income from higher interest rates.

flag HMRC is contacting UK households with unexpected tax bills due to higher interest rates causing savings income to exceed the tax-free allowance. flag This is the first time in over a decade that HMRC is reaching out, as many savers are now facing tax on their savings interest. flag Basic-rate taxpayers can earn up to £1,000 tax-free, but those with multiple accounts, overseas savings, or over £10,000 in savings income may need to contact HMRC directly.
